Output 61106b7f9797414797dd525d17a166edd7b64bd414883b8630ddb64754180e68:7

value
349058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b3bd727a3e60a089f842fcccfb06b0c6293445f OP_EQUAL
address
3QbRDUpV94VRRAh9C73C2nXwvEJnmzYP9H
transaction
61106b7f9797414797dd525d17a166edd7b64bd414883b8630ddb64754180e68
spent
true